The coasties give news conferences for the retard media, who know as much about boats as fucking astrophysics. When you listen to the actual facts, the boat likely went down last Thursday. So with one body in a suit they found , but tossed back, you likely looking at just recovery. There's no one alive to find. The key is lots of scattered survival suits but empty ones. Lifeboat found smashed to a pulp; which means probably went down with ship and crushed then popped up. No updates other than the technical updates of who's searching, but they haven't found anything but some scattered debris now. Back end of a conex box which looks torn off not imploded. But no bodies, nothing.

Search was abandoned at sunset yesterday. Even a search for the hull will be difficult, since the water is rather deep in the area, > 2000m

NTSB has the lead now
